To Refinance, Or Not To Refinance?

Home Mortgage Refinancing

Many homeowners across the country are discovering the advantages of a low mortgage rate refinance. So what is it, and how can you get one? A refinance involves taking on a new mortgage with a better interest rate and term with the goal of paying off the original mortgage. Homeowners can choose not to go with their original lender, allowing them to shop around for the best rate.

Graduated Home Mortgage In The Great State Of Tennessee

Home Mortgage Refinancing

The Graduated Payment Mortgages also known as the GPM, which has a low monthly payment initially, but is set to increase by a preset percentage every year over a period of time. The period of the payment is typically from 5 years to 20 years. At the end of the period the increment in the installments stop and then the borrower has to pay the same monthly installment.

Zero Down Mortgage Loans - Understanding Zero Down Mortgages

Home Mortgage Refinancing

In numerous housing markets across the country, the increase in house costs does not match the average household earnings. Hence, many people can’t seem to conserve cash for any down payment. Ideally, mortgage companies favor applicants to have a down payment of a minimum of 5%, in addition to paying closing costs. Regrettably, this really is an unrealistic expectation. Thus, many home buyers are taking benefit of zero down mortgage loans.
